About this fabric

This Linwood upholstery fabric is woven from 30% wool and 70% cotton, with an approximate width of 137cm. In the Ochre colourway, lighter flecks and tan highlights interrupt the ochre ground, giving the surface subtle depth rather than a flat yellow tone. The small broken diagonal motifs form an understated geometric pattern that reads clearly at close range without dominating the textile. It is specified for fixed upholstery in Contract and General Domestic settings, with Dry Clean after-care.

How to use it

Use Westray Ochre on a compact sofa, armchair or dining seat where its warm golden-brown tone can sit comfortably with oak, walnut, natural linen and softened cream. The textured geometric surface also works well as a tonal counterpoint to plain cushions in ecru or deep brown.
